sorry john but the days of running bent are long gone with digitachos and big fines, as you can see from my profile i live near malaga so 1st tacho gets me to almazan 2nd to vivonne 3rd gets me to the M25 so 4th tacho gets me nearly anywhere in UK, then reverse the process is the same mileage plus you need a 24 off so when i get home i take 45 plus 21, like i said whats the point of having a place in spain if you don’t take time to appreciate it?

I understand that WBIS, makes you think tho doesn`t it? how times have changed.
The way you said where you stop and how far you can get each day, makes it sound like a milk round, we just used to get as far as we could as quick as we could, tip, wash out, get to reload asap, then back up, then do it again to wherever we were asked to go.
And every trip was different even the calf job, where we had trucks going most days of the week to the same places, sometimes we would meet and run with someone, one of our own, or a Dutch pig truck etc and we would “light them up “or we would just plod on down on our own, every trip was different.We very rarely ran with U.K trucks, we were frowned upon,usual crap,” young blokes racing about, and pinching everyones loads”(just because we backloaded anything and everything in livestock boxes). Truth is, yes we worked very hard, but we were paid very well and always had the kit to do the job.Best job I ever had.
